Next AFP chief of staff to be chosen amongst 5 candidates

The list of candidates for the Armed Forces of the Philippines (AFP) chief of staff post has already been submitted to Malacañang in preparation for General Benjamin Madrigal Jr.’s upcoming retirement. AFP Spokesperson Brigadier General Edgard Arevalo says that there are five possible choices for Madrigal’s replacement and the list includes ‘seasoned three star generals’ whose names are undisclosed as of press time.
